A strong addition to Houston's Sushi line-up 4/20/2010

What a great addition to Houston?s already impressive Sushi restaurant line-up. Sushi Raku delights us with some of the finest fish flown in from Japan itself. From what I hear, they receive numerous shipments each month so that they are able to serve fish as fresh as possible. The man with the plan is renowned chef Taka of Japan and with him behind the knife you are surely in for a treat. My dinner started with a smile from a very beautiful hostess that kindly showed us to our seats and presented us with our menus. I then realized I was in the middle of a just gorgeous restaurant that was designed to catch anyone?s attention. As the server approached he kindly asked if this was our first time at Sushi Raku and with a firm yes from me he then gave us a quick rundown of the place and menu. Which is quite extensive if you ask me but he noted as the restaurant is still in its soft opening stage the menu will still get a few tweaks. On to the food, as I was already impressed with the decor I was also intrigued by some of the menu items. I ordered the popcorn crab with seven spices to start off and would definitely recommend anyone to try it. The main course consisted of some more common rolls and one in particular that I chose to be my favorite of the night. The orange dragon roll is made of spicy tuna, avocado, tempura crunch, ponzu sauce and not mentioned on the menu a delicious piece of salmon is placed on top. To top off the night and satisfy my sweet tooth I chose their vanilla kabocha bean cream brulee which I have no words for because I am now drooling again thinking about it. Pros: Decor, Service, Food Cons: Price can be a bit high. more

Owner Message
  • Houston's Premier Sushi Bar - The only restaurant that brings freshest fish from world's famous "Tsukiji Fish Market" - Japan. Famed Executive Chef Taka utilizing ingredients from different parts of world. Sushi Raku is a restaurant caters to Houston's culinary eccentricities. Signature dishes like "Kobe Steak" - kabocha squash puree, wasabi port demi, "Almond Lamb Chop" - satsuma yam, haricot vert, star anise aged sake reduction. With a decidedly modern ambiance and chic japanese decor. Sushi Raku's rain chain provides a relaxing, yet elegant and warm atmosphere. Traditional samurai armor intensifies the surroundings. Dramatic red ropes partitioned the Bar/Lounge from the dinning room. Giant oil paintings (Samurai & Geisha) decorates each private party room.
